(Case Study Overview and Findings of Course-Specific Lessons) The platform adopted for use here was the Virtual Indiana Classroom distance education network. This was a radical innovation when it was introduced in 1995 and the entire scheme was presented by the Dean of the School of Continuing Studies to the Indiana University faculty at their annual meeting. This started off with the opportunity to teach students on all the campuses of Indiana University through creativity and excellence. This has also raised many questions about learning, logistics and budgets. The deficiencies are not necessarily of software, but arise also from the deficiencies of the teaching methods. In any case, overcoming any shortcoming requires time and repeat experimentation with different batches of students till the method is found to be successful in sending the required knowledge to the students and their being able to reach a certain level of proficiency. Thus the concerned package used should be a platform suitable for the purpose. The platform is called Virtual Indiana Classroom or VIC and the package works on all types of transmission of computer signal transmission - Internet, cable, direct signals, etc.
